What Does Mighty Well Drilling's Well Maintenance Service Include?

Our well maintenance service provides a thorough inspection and proactive care for your entire private well system, from the wellhead down to the submersible pump. This includes checking the well casing for integrity, inspecting the electrical connections and wiring, verifying pressure tank function and air charge, and testing the water for common contaminants like coliform bacteria and nitrates. We also assess the pump's performance, measuring flow rates and pressure switch cut-in/cut-out settings to ensure they meet your household's demands efficiently.

Our approach is systematic. We begin with a visual inspection of the wellhead and surrounding area for any signs of damage or potential contamination sources. Then, we move to the pressure tank, checking for proper air pressure and diaphragm integrity, which is critical for consistent water delivery and pump longevity. We'll cycle the pump to observe its operation, listen for unusual noises, and measure amperage draw to detect early signs of wear or inefficiency. This detailed review helps us identify potential issues before they escalate into major failures.

For Kalamazoo properties, regular well maintenance is particularly important because of our varied soil compositions and seasonal temperature fluctuations. Clay soils can lead to casing stress over time, and the freeze-thaw cycles common in Michigan winters can impact exposed plumbing and electrical components. Proactive maintenance helps mitigate these local environmental challenges, which means your well system is better prepared to handle the demands placed upon it year-round without unexpected interruptions.

Homeowners often wonder about the frequency of maintenance or what signs indicate a problem. We generally recommend an annual check-up, but if you notice changes in water pressure, unusual noises from the pump or tank, cloudy or discolored water, or a sudden increase in your electricity bill, it's time for an inspection. These symptoms often point to underlying issues that can be addressed quickly during a maintenance visit, preventing more significant damage to your well system and ensuring your family's access to clean water.

During our maintenance visits, we use calibrated equipment to ensure accurate readings for pressure and flow. Any replacement parts, such as pressure switches or gauges, are sourced from reputable manufacturers like Square D or Grundfos, ensuring compatibility and reliability within your existing system. We provide a detailed report of our findings, including water test results and any recommendations for repairs or upgrades, so you have a clear understanding of your well's condition.

Why is Regular Well Maintenance Essential for Kalamazoo Homeowners?

Regular well maintenance is essential for Kalamazoo homeowners because it directly impacts the longevity and reliability of their private water supply. The average lifespan of a well pump can be significantly extended with proper care, avoiding premature failure that often leads to costly emergency replacements. Proactive checks help identify minor issues, like a failing pressure switch or a corroded electrical connection, before they cause a complete system shutdown.

Kalamazoo's climate, with its distinct seasons, places unique demands on well systems. Freezing temperatures can stress exposed pipes and pressure tanks, while spring thaws and heavy rains can introduce sediment or surface contaminants into the well. Routine maintenance includes inspecting for these vulnerabilities and ensuring the well cap and casing are sealed against environmental intrusion, which means your water quality remains consistently high, regardless of the weather.

Beyond preventing breakdowns, maintenance also safeguards your family's health by ensuring water quality. We conduct basic water quality tests during maintenance visits to detect common issues that might not be immediately apparent. This early detection is crucial for addressing potential contamination sources promptly, providing you with confidence in the safety of your drinking water.

Our Well Maintenance Process in Kalamazoo

1

Initial System Assessment

We begin with a comprehensive visual inspection of your entire well system, including the wellhead, casing, pressure tank, and visible plumbing. We look for signs of corrosion, leaks, physical damage, or environmental intrusion that could compromise your water supply.

2

Performance & Pressure Check

We test your pump's performance by measuring flow rates and verifying the pressure switch's cut-in and cut-out settings. We also check the pressure tank's air charge to ensure it's operating efficiently and preventing short cycling of your pump.

3

Water Quality Sampling

We collect a water sample for basic on-site testing, focusing on common indicators like pH, hardness, and the presence of coliform bacteria or nitrates. This provides a snapshot of your water quality and helps identify potential issues needing further lab analysis.

4

Detailed Report & Recommendations

Following our assessment, we provide a detailed report outlining the condition of your well system, any detected issues, and our specific recommendations for repairs or preventive measures. We explain our findings clearly, ensuring you understand the necessary steps to maintain your well's health.

You should have your well maintained annually by a qualified professional in Kalamazoo. This annual check-up helps identify potential issues early, prevents unexpected breakdowns, and ensures your water quality remains safe. If you notice any changes in water pressure or quality, an earlier inspection may be necessary.
Signs that your well needs maintenance or repair include a noticeable drop in water pressure, unusual noises coming from your pump or pressure tank, cloudy or discolored water, or an unexpected increase in your electricity bill. If your pump is cycling on and off more frequently than usual, that's also a strong indicator of a potential problem with the pressure tank or switch. Addressing these symptoms promptly can prevent more extensive and costly repairs.
